A Hopeful Thanksgiving Tradition
Date: November 23, 2010
Ray Allen was in the holiday spirit while handing out Thanksgiving meals at the Boston Center for Youth & Families in Mattapan. Allen donated hundreds of meals over multiple Thanksgiving holidays in Boston through his Ray of Hope Foundation. “I think about my childhood and the things I didn’t have and I felt like I was rich even though we weren’t financially rich,” said Allen in 2013, when he continued the Thanksgiving program as a member of the Miami Heat. “Now as I’m in the position that I’m in I try to make sure to give back as much as I can because there are so many people that don’t have just the basic minimums. Just having food in the pantry. That’s the cornerstone of Thanksgiving.”
